Output 5894a8ca333071fbdef79943b7152e68cfd2e5dca8e559e96295bde590690ad5:0

value
18292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963d5eac68ef534f9179f2565f48d4e56744e49a OP_EQUAL
address
3FPQoNJMQHo71oNdimiG6nmHCzQj5CY3k5
transaction
5894a8ca333071fbdef79943b7152e68cfd2e5dca8e559e96295bde590690ad5
confirmations
219380
spent
true